Eagle Nebula
Home to the iconic Pillars of Creation, where dense molecular columns are being sculpted by UV radiation from a nearby young star cluster.
The Eagle Nebula is an H II region and young star cluster (NGC 6611) roughly
5,700 light-years away. The Pillars of Creation — three towering columns of
molecular gas — became iconic after Hubble's 1995 image. O-type stars in NGC
6611 blast the surrounding gas with ionising UV photons, sculpting the pillars
through a process called photoevaporation. In radio, cold CO line emission traces
the dense molecular reservoir feeding the pillars. Spitzer revealed IR emission
from the warm dust eroding pillar surfaces. The 2022 JWST NIRCam image resolved
individual protostars embedded within the pillars, previously hidden from optical
view. GALEX UV imaging shows the intense radiation field from the cluster ionising
the nebula. Chandra X-ray observations reveal dozens of young, pre-main-sequence
stellar X-ray sources within the cluster, as young stars are prolific X-ray
emitters. Together the wavelengths capture a star formation factory in action.
